Oman Cricket has found itself in a controversial predicament following a delayed disbursement of prize money from the ICC Men's T20 World Cup 2024. The funds, originally due, will now only be distributed by July 2025, causing unrest among players over monetary concerns.

The board maintains that the delay is procedural as they're waiting on post-event clarifications from the ICC, which commonly occur after global tournaments. This explanation has not placated 11 senior team members, who withdrew from an important tournament in protest.

In response to the walkout, the Oman Cricket Board conducted emergency meetings, ultimately deciding to terminate the contracts of the dissenting players due to what they describe as a breach of obligations. To prevent such occurrences in the future, they plan to improve communication and clarify future compensation structures.
